What Are Functional Beverages?

People often ask what a functional beverage is. It is a drink built to support a goal like calm, focus, gut health, or hydration. It tastes good and includes active ingredients with a clear purpose. Common additions include adaptogens such as ashwagandha or reishi, probiotics for digestion, and electrolytes like potassium and magnesium.

Traditional sodas chase flavor and fizz. Functional drinks pair flavor with a defined benefit. Many cut added sugar and use clear labels so you can see what each can or bottle is meant to do.

Functional Beverages Breakdown: Inside the Bottle of Wellness

Different formulas in functional beverages guide energy, mood, and hydration. Each blend pairs science with flavor, where taste leads and wellness follows. Below is a breakdown of how these drinks support your day from focus to rest.

Mind: Focus and Energy

These functional beverages sharpen clarity, elevate alertness, and deliver smooth energy without the crash. Perfect for mornings, deep-work sessions, or pre-workout focus.

Drink Type Key Ingredient(s) Taste Profile How It Helps
Nootropic coffee L-theanine, ginseng Smooth roasted with a mild herbal finish Enhances focus and alertness while reducing jitters
Brain-fuel tonic Rhodiola, ginkgo Light citrus-herbal Improves memory, concentration, and endurance
Adaptogenic energy drink Caffeine + ashwagandha Crisp and mildly sweet Balances energy and reduces stress response
Matcha green tea L-theanine, catechins Earthy and grassy Sustains mental clarity and calm alertness
Yerba mate Natural caffeine, antioxidants Slightly bitter with a floral aroma Boosts energy and supports metabolism
Functional cold brew L-carnitine, B-vitamins Bold coffee with nutty tones Supports brain and muscle energy
Mushroom elixir Lion’s mane, cordyceps Earthy with cacao notes Promotes focus, creativity, and stamina
Nootropic soda Panax ginseng, guarana Fruity fizz Provides clean, long-lasting energy

 

Body: Gut Health and Hydration

These functional drinks strengthen digestion, balance hydration, and help your body recover smoothly. They’re perfect after meals, workouts, or long outdoor days.

Drink Type Key Ingredient(s) Taste Profile How It Helps
Probiotic soda Olipop, Poppi, live cultures Sweet-tart and fizzy Supports a healthy gut microbiome
Kombucha Green or black tea, probiotics Tangy with light fruit Aids digestion and immunity
Electrolyte water Magnesium, potassium Neutral or lemon-lime Rehydrates and balances minerals
Collagen sparkling drink Collagen peptides, vitamin C Light berry or citrus Supports skin and joint health
Coconut water Natural electrolytes Mildly sweet and nutty Replenishes fluids and nutrients
Aloe vera juice Aloe extract Crisp herbal Soothes digestion and hydrates cells
Ginger tonic Fresh ginger, lemon Spicy-citrus Eases bloating and improves circulation
Chlorophyll water Chlorophyll extract Mild minty green Detoxifies and oxygenates the body
Mineral seltzer Sea minerals, sodium Light and bubbly Restores electrolyte balance post-exercise
Herbal digestive tea Peppermint, fennel Cool and refreshing Calms the stomach and supports digestion

 

Mood: Calm and Relaxation

These blends ease tension, calm the nervous system, and promote gentle rest, ideal for unwinding in the evening or re-centering mid-day.

Drink Type Key Ingredient(s) Taste Profile How It Helps
Adaptogenic tea Ashwagandha, reishi Earthy and smooth Reduces cortisol and promotes calm
Botanical elixir Lavender, lemon balm Floral with citrus hint Relaxes muscles and eases anxiety
Magnesium tonic Magnesium glycinate, chamomile Light citrus-herbal Supports relaxation and better sleep
CBD sparkling water Hemp extract Neutral with slight bitterness Calms nerves without intoxication
Functional cacao Raw cacao, maca Rich chocolate Lifts mood and balances hormones
Relaxing kombucha Chamomile, honey Mildly sweet and floral Soothes the mind and digestion
Sleep-support elixir Valerian, passionflower Herbal and slightly sweet Promotes deeper sleep cycles
Calm soda Lemon balm, magnesium Tart citrus fizz Lowers stress and promotes clarity
Adaptogenic latte Reishi, vanilla Creamy and warm Grounds energy and improves resilience
Turmeric-ginger shot Turmeric, black pepper Spicy and earthy Reduces inflammation and supports calm recovery

Choosing the Right Functional Drink

Choose with purpose. Match the can to the job, read the label, then test one change at a time.

1. Match Your Goal

  • For focus → look for L-theanine or Rhodiola
  • For calm → choose ashwagandha or magnesium blends
  • For hydration → pick electrolytes or coconut-based waters

2. Read Labels Wisely

Check sugar per serving and the dose of key ingredients. Use products with clear ingredient names you recognize. Avoid artificial sweeteners that hide under vague “natural” claims.

3. Start Small

Try one type for a week. Track when you drink it and how you respond. Adjust timing. Adjust the dose only if the label allows. Ask yourself, “Does it help you stay clear, calm, or both?”

FAQs

What makes functional beverages different from regular drinks?

They target a clear benefit along with taste. You get support for focus, calm, gut health, or hydration, not flavor alone.

Are functional drinks healthy?

They can be when labels show real doses and low sugar. Choose trusted brands and track your response for a week.

What are common functional beverage ingredients?

Adaptogens such as ashwagandha or reishi, probiotics for digestion, and electrolytes like potassium and magnesium. These aim at a daily balance.
